Executive Summary: The Geddy Lee Signature Tone Architecture & Factory OEM Ecosystem
In the demanding world of professional audio reproduction, the signature bass sound of Geddy Lee (Rush) represents the pinnacle of bass tone engineering: a complex, punchy combination of massive low-end clarity combined with aggressive, tube-like midrange saturation. Achieving this tone traditionally required bi-amping setups involving massive SVT rigs, mic'd cabinet isolation booths, and custom rackmount preamplifiers.
The introduction of the Geddy Lee Signature SansAmp series (including the YYZ pedal, GED-2112 rackmount, and YY-DI units) solved this engineering bottleneck by embedding Tech 21's proprietary all-analog FET (Field Effect Transistor) modeling architecture into compact, direct-injection (DI) hardware formats. Analog Signal Topology: Why All-Analog SansAmp Technology Outperforms Digital Modeler Pedals
While modern digital multi-effects processors attempt to replicate analog preamps using DSP algorithm blocks and Impulse Response (IR) convolvers, live touring engineers and studio producers in Hanoi frequently experience latency artifacts, digital harshness, and dynamic compression when digital units are pushed into high distortion.
The Geddy Lee Signature SansAmp utilizes a 100% discrete analog signal path that mimics the continuous non-linear transfer functions of vintage vacuum tube triodes. The architecture splits the incoming instrument signal into two distinct parallel paths:
1. The "Deep" Channel Path
Delivers a crystal-clear, un-distorted sub-bass foundation with active EQ curves specifically calibrated between 40Hz and 120Hz to maintain low-end tightness without muddying the mix.
2. The "Drive" Channel Path
Emulates an overdriven high-wattage tube stack, introducing rich second and third-order harmonic distortion from upper-midrange to high frequencies without stripping low frequency energy.
3. Dynamic Matrix Blending
Combines both streams into a phase-coherent, low-impedance balanced XLR direct output capable of driving Front-of-House (FOH) mixing consoles over 100-meter snake lines.

Localized Application Scenarios: Hanoi's Music & Commercial Audio Landscape
Operating professional audio hardware in Hanoi presents unique environmental and operational challenges. As the capital of Vietnam undergoes rapid growth in live music venues, upscale Tây Hồ lounge bars, TV broadcast studios, and touring outdoor festivals, equipment must adapt to regional conditions:
1. Live Performance Venues in Tây Hồ & Hoàn Kiếm (Old Quarter)
Venues operating in historic buildings often face strict sound pressure level (SPL) limits and acoustic isolation issues. Traditional 8x10 bass cabinet stacks produce low-frequency resonance that leaks into surrounding residential zoning. By equipping resident bassists with Geddy Lee Signature SansAmp preamps direct to FOH, venues maintain full studio-quality bass punch through in-ear monitor (IEM) systems while eliminating stage volume spill completely.
2. Weather-Proofing for Hanoi's Humid & Tropical Climate
Hanoi experiences extreme relative humidity levels (exceeding 90% during the Nồm moisture season in spring) alongside temperature fluctuations. Standard consumer-grade audio electronics are prone to potentiometer corrosion, solder joint oxidation, and PCB short-circuiting. Premium factory OEM manufacturers supplying Hanoi implement military-grade conformal coating on internal PCBs, gold-plated switch contacts, and sealed potentiometers to guarantee uninterrupted operation during outdoor summer performances in Ba Đình or Nam Từ Liêm districts.
3. Voltage Stability & Clean DC Power Regulation
Power grids in certain commercial districts can experience voltage sags or high-frequency line noise caused by heavy industrial equipment nearby. OEM SansAmp factory designs incorporate internal voltage regulation circuitry and reverse-polarity protection diodes, filtering dirty 9V DC input power and preserving internal headroom even under erratic power grid conditions.
